MySQL数据库快速清空一键操作搞定(mysql一键清空)

MySQL数据库快速清空:一键操作搞定!

随着互联网应用的普及,数据库的使用越来越广泛。而在开发、测试或者维护阶段,经常需要清空数据库来进行下一轮测试或维护工作,这时候一个快速清空数据库的方法显得非常重要。本文将介绍一种MySQL数据库快速清空的方法:一键操作搞定!

第一步:备份数据

在进行数据库清空操作之前,预先备份数据显得非常重要,以防万一。备份操作可以通过命令行也可以通过图形界面完成。

1.备份命令行操作

使用mysqldump命令备份数据库,命令如下所示:

“` shell

mysqldump -h hostname -u root -p mydatabase > mydatabase.sql


其中:

- hostname为主机名,如果在本机操作,则用localhost代替;
- root为数据库管理员的用户名;
- mydatabase为要备份的数据库名称;
- mydatabase.sql为备份文件的保存路径和文件名。
2.备份图形界面操作

使用MySQL Workbench,点击菜单中的“Server”->“Data Export”进行数据备份,具体操作可以参考MySQL官方文档。

第二步:清空数据

备份完成之后,就可以进行数据库清空操作了。可以通过命令行也可以通过图形界面完成。

1.清空命令行操作

使用DROP DATABASE命令清空数据库,命令如下所示:

``` shell
mysql -h hostname -u root -p -e "DROP DATABASE mydatabase;"

其中:

– hostname为主机名,如果在本机操作,则用localhost代替;

– root为数据库管理员的用户名;

– mydatabase为要清空的数据库名称。

2.清空图形界面操作

使用MySQL Workbench,点击菜单中的“Navigator”->“Data Export”进行数据清空,具体操作可以参考MySQL官方文档。

第三步:还原数据

如果备份完成之后,需要还原数据,则可以通过命令行也可以通过图形界面完成还原操作。

1.还原命令行操作

使用mysql命令还原数据库,命令如下所示:

“` shell

mysql -h hostname -u root -p mydatabase


其中:

- hostname为主机名,如果在本机操作,则用localhost代替;
- root为数据库管理员的用户名;
- mydatabase为要还原的数据库名称;
- mydatabase.sql为备份文件的路径和文件名。
2.还原图形界面操作

使用MySQL Workbench,点击菜单中的“Navigator”->“Data Import”进行数据还原,具体操作可以参考MySQL官方文档。

综上所述,本文介绍了一种快速清空MySQL数据库的方法,操作简单、一键启动,适合开发、测试和维护人员快速完成数据库清空及还原操作。同时,在进行任何数据库操作之前,我们都应该牢记:备份数据库是非常重要的!

数据运维技术 » MySQL数据库快速清空一键操作搞定(mysql一键清空)